Turn the key alternator light flashes and makes noise like a turn signal. Does not go out when I start the car.
I see 14v across the + and - on the battery with engine running and 12.3 or so with engine off.
Replaced VR with no change.
PO changed the electrical portion of the ignition switch because you could remove the key and the car would keep running. My wipers work and my horn does not.
I don’t think horn is related because I removed the batwing and the cable is not connected.
sportlicherFahrer
Sounds like you may want to verify how the wires are hooked up on the back of the instrument. Seems like your alternator light is operating like the brake warning light.

When you turn the key on do any other lights come on near the alt light? Do they go out when the engine is started? Does the light in question still act the same way with the parking brake off?
